当前位置:首页 >> 工学 >>

单片机原理及应用复习题


《单片机原理及应用》复习题 28. MCS-51 单片机外部中断请求信号有电平 方式和 脉冲 方式,在电平方式 下,当采集到 INT0、INT1 的有效信号为 低电平时 时,激活外部中断。 30. 一个字节可以存 2 位 BCD 码。 31.对 89C51 而言,片内 ROM 和片外 ROM 的编址方式为 统一编址 ,片外 ROM 的地址从 1000H 开始; 片内 RAM 和片外 RAM 的编址方式为独立编址 , 片外 RAM 的地址从 0000H 开始。 32.对单片机而言,连接到数据总线上的输出口应具有 锁存 功能, 连接到数 据总线上的输出口应具有 三态 功能。 33.决定程序执行的顺序是 PC 寄存器,该寄存器复位时的值为 0000H 。 34.MCS-5l 单片机的堆栈区只可设置在__片内数据存储区的低 128 字节,堆栈寄存 器 SP 是_8_位寄存器。 35. MCS-51 单片机指令 ADDC A, #20H 中源操作数的寻址方式是_立即数寻址__。 36.串行通信根据通信的数据格式分有两种方式,分别是 同步 和 异步 。 38.MCS-51 单片机 89C51 中有 2 个 16 位的定时/计数器,可以被设 定的工作方式有 4 种。 39. 在 MCS-51 中 PC 和 DPTR 都用于提供地址,其中 PC 为访问 程序 存储 器提供地址,DPTR 为访问 数据 存储器提供地址 40.通过堆栈操作实现子程序调用,首先要把 PC 的内容入栈,以进行断 点保护。 42.一个 10 位 D/A 转换器,其分辨率为____2-10____。 43. 8051 复位后, PC=00 H。 若希望从片内存储器开始执行, EA 脚应接__高______ 电平, PC 值超过__0FFFH______时, 8051 会自动转向片外存储器继续取指令执行。 44.单片机内包含组成微机的三个主要功能部件是 CPU、存储器和_各种 I/O 接 口__。 46. 若由程序设定 RS1、 RS0=10, 则工作寄存器 R0~R7 的直接地址为_10~17H__。 47.串行通讯中有同步和 异步 两种基本方式。 48. 7 段 LED 显示器内部的发光二极管连接方式可分为共阴极和 共阳极 两 种结构。 51.MCS-51 单片机的 P0 口和 P2 口除了可以作为并行口进行数据的输入/输出 外,通常还用来构建系统的_低 8 位地址_______和___高 8 位地址_____。 53.MCS-51 单片机指令 ANL A,20H 中源操作数的寻址方式是__直接寻址____。 54.将 CY 与 A 的第 0 位的“非”求“或”的指令是 ORL C,/ACC.0,若原 A=0, 执行后 A=___00H___ 60.8051 的堆栈指针是__SP____。 64.执行下列程序段中第一条指令后,(1)(P1.7)=_0_ (P1.3)=__0___, (P1.2)=_____0____;执行第二条指令后, (2) (P1.5)=___1______, (P1.4) =_____1____,(P1.3)=_____1____. ANL P1,#73H 01110011 ORL P1,#38H 00111000 67.阅读下列程序段并回答问题。 1)该程序执行何种操作? 单字节 BCD 码运算,进行十进制调整后,存入到 62H 中。
1

2)已知初值(60H)=23H, (61H)=61H,运行程序后(62H)=38H。 CLR C MOV A,#9AH SUBB A,60H ADD A,61H DA A MOV 62H,A 70.指出下列程序的功能 ORG 0200H MOV DPTR,#1000H MOV R0,#20H LOOP: MOVX A,@DPTR MOV @R0,A INC DPTR INC R0 CJNE R0,#71H,LOOP SJMP $ 程序功能是: 把片外数据存储器 1000H~1050H 中的内容传送到片内数据存储器 20H~70H 中。 73.数据存放在 8031 单片机的内部 RAM, 分别在 30H、 31H、 32H 单元和 50H、 51H、 52H 单元存放三字节数据,试编写程序求两数之和,并存到 60H、61H、62H 单元。 (数据存放次序是低字节放在低位地址。不考虑最后进位)
ORG 0000H CLR C MOV A,30H ADD A,50H MOV 60H,A MOV A, 31H ADDC A,51H MOV 61H,A MOV A, 32H ADDC A,52H MOV 62H,A SJMP $ END (不考虑最后进位)

77.下列程序段执行后, (R0)=__7EH _______, (7EH)=___0FFH______, (7 FH)=_____3F ____. MOV R0,#7FH MOV 7EH,#0 MOV 7FH,#40H DEC @R0 DEC R0 DEC @R0 79. 89C51 单片机有 5 个中断源 , CPU 响应中断时,中断入口地址各是
2

0003H,000BH,0013H,001BH,0023H。 85. 已知 (SP) =09H, (DPTR) =4567H,在执行下列指令后, (SP) =___0BH______, 内部 RAM(0AH)=____67H_____, (0BH)=____45H_____ PUSH DPL 0A PUSH DPH 0B 90.阅读程序并填空, 形成完整的程序以实现如下功能:有一长度为 10 字节的字 符串存放在 8031 内部 RAM 中,其首地址为 40H。要求将该字符串中每一个字符 加偶校验位。 (以调用子程序的方法来实现。 ) 源程序如下: ORG 1000H MOV R0,#40H MOV R7,#10 NEXT: MOV A, ① ACALL X1 MOV @R0,A INC R0 DJNZ ② ,NEXT SJMP $ X1: ADD A,#00H ③ PSW.0,X2 ORL A, ④ X2: ⑤ :
① @R0 ② R7 ③ JNB ④ #80H ⑤ RET

95.用 8051 的 P1 口接 8 个 LED 发光二极管,由 INT0 接一个消抖按键开关,开 始 P1.0 的 LED 亮,以后由 INT0 按键每中断一次,下一个 LED 亮,顺序下移,且 每次只一个 LED 亮,周而复始。请编制程序。

ORG 0000H SJMP START ORG 0003H SJMP X0_INT
3

START: MOV IE, #10000001B MOV A, #7FH MOV P1, A SJMP $ X0_INT: RL A MOV P1, A JNB INT0, $ RETI END 96.编程将内部数据存储器 20H~24H 单元压缩的 BCD 码转换成 ASCⅡ存放在于 25H 开始的单元。
参考程序:注意压缩 BCD 嘛为一个字节占两位 BCD 码! ORG 0000H MOV R7,#05H ;R7 为转换字节数 MOV R0, #20H ;R0 为源操作数地址 MOV R1,#25H ;R7 为目的操作数地址 NE:MOV A,@R0 ANL A,#0FH ;先取低位 BCD 码 ADD A,#30H ;将 BCD 码转换成 ASCII 码 MOV @R1,A INC R1 MOV A,@R0 ANL A,#0F0H ;取高位 BCD 码 SWAP A ;半字节交换 ADD A,#30H ;将 BCD 码转换成 ASCII 码 MOV @R1,A INC R1 DJNZ R7,NE SJMP $ END

97.请使用位操作指令,实现下列逻辑操作: P1.5=ACC.2∧P2.7∨ACC.1∧P2.0 MOV ANL MOV MOV ANL ORL MOV C, ACC.1 C,P2.0 12H, C C,ACC.2 C,P2.7 C,12H P1.5,C
4

RET 100.. 已知一单片机系统的外接晶体振荡器的振荡频率为 11.059MHz , 请计 算该单片机系统的拍节 P 、状态 S 、机器周期所对应的时间是多少 ?指令周 期中的单字节双周期指令的执行时间是多少 ? 机器周期所对应的时间是 P=1/11.059M S=2P Tcy=12/11.059M 单字节双周期指令的执行时间是 2Tcy

5


相关文章:
单片机原理及应用期末考试题试卷及答案大全.doc
单片机原理及应用期末考试题试卷及答案大全 - 一、选择题(每题 1 分,共 10
单片机原理及应用考试试题及答案.doc
单片机原理及应用考试试题及答案 - 单片机原理及应用试题一 一、填空题(每空 1
单片机原理及应用期末复习题库.doc
单片机原理及应用期末复习题库 - 一、填空题 1.十进制 255 的二进制是 1
《单片机原理及应用》期末复习题1.doc
单片机原理及应用》期末复习题1 - 一、填空题 1、 若采用 6MHz 的晶体
单片机原理及应用期末复习题库(含答案).doc
单片机原理及应用期末复习题库(含答案) - 一、填空题 1.十进制 255 的二
超全含答案~~~单片机原理及应用期末考试题试卷大全.doc
超全含答案~~~单片机原理及应用期末考试题试卷大全 - 单片机模拟试卷 00
单片机原理与应用复习资料.doc
单片机原理与应用复习资料 - 单片机原理及应用考试复习知识点 第 1 章 计算机
单片机原理及应用复习题.doc
单片机原理及应用复习题_工学_高等教育_教育专区。成都理工大学单片机原理及应用复习题 1. MCS-51 单片机的片内都集成了哪些功能部件?各个功能部件的最主要的功能...
单片机原理及应用复习题.doc
单片机原理及应用复习题_工学_高等教育_教育专区。山东理工大学成人高等教育 单片
单片机原理及应用复习题及答案.doc
单片机原理及应用复习题及答案 - 单片机原理及应用复习题及答案 一,选择题(在每
《单片机原理及应用》复习试题.doc
单片机原理及应用复习试题 - 《单片机原理及应用》 一、填空题 1.十进制数
单片机原理及应用复习题.doc
单片机原理及应用复习题_工学_高等教育_教育专区。期末考复习题 1 、单片机是计
单片机原理及应用复习题.doc
单片机原理及应用复习题 - 《单片机原理及应用》复习题 1.在下列 MCS-5l
单片机原理及应用考试试题及答案[1].doc
单片机原理及应用考试试题及答案[1] - 单片机原理及应用试题一 一、填空题(每
单片机原理及应用复习题.txt
单片机原理及应用复习题 - 一、选择题(在每个小题四个备选答案中选出一个正确答案
《单片机原理及应用》期末复习题1.doc
单片机原理及应用》期末复习题1 - 一、填空题 1、若采用 6MHz 的晶体振
单片机原理及应用复习题部分参考答案.pdf
单片机原理及应用复习题部分参考答案 - 本文由aengeghoh贡献 doc1。
51单片机原理及应用期末考试试题复习.doc
51单片机原理及应用期末考试试题复习 - 单片机原理及应用 期末考试试题汇总 1
单片机原理及应用练习题改.doc
单片机原理及应用练习题改 - 单片机原理及应用练习题 一、 单向选择题: )有效
单片机原理及应用期末复习题.doc
单片机原理及应用期末复习题 - 单片机模拟试卷 001 一、选择题(每题 1 分
更多相关标签: